+func parseBindings(userBindings map[string]string) {
+       for k, v := range userBindings {
+               BindKey(k, v)
+       }
+}
+
+// findKey will find binding Key 'b' using string 'k'
+func findKey(k string) (b Key, ok bool) {
+       modifiers := tcell.ModNone
+
+       // First, we'll strip off all the modifiers in the name and add them to the
+       // ModMask
+modSearch:
+       for {
+               switch {
+               case strings.HasPrefix(k, "-"):
+                       // We optionally support dashes between modifiers
+                       k = k[1:]
+               case strings.HasPrefix(k, "Ctrl"):
+                       k = k[4:]
+                       modifiers |= tcell.ModCtrl
+               case strings.HasPrefix(k, "Alt"):
+                       k = k[3:]
+                       modifiers |= tcell.ModAlt
+               case strings.HasPrefix(k, "Shift"):
+                       k = k[5:]
+                       modifiers |= tcell.ModShift
+               default:
+                       break modSearch
+               }
        }
-       for k, v := range parsed {
-               bindings[keys[k]] = actions[v]
+
+       // Control is handled specially, since some character codes in bindingKeys
+       // are different when Control is depressed. We should check for Control keys
+       // first.
+       if modifiers&tcell.ModCtrl != 0 {
+               // see if the key is in bindingKeys with the Ctrl prefix.
+               if code, ok := bindingKeys["Ctrl"+k]; ok {
+                       // It is, we're done.
+                       return Key{
+                               keyCode:   code,
+                               modifiers: modifiers,
+                               r:         0,
+                       }, true
+               }
+       }
+
+       // See if we can find the key in bindingKeys
+       if code, ok := bindingKeys[k]; ok {
+               return Key{
+                       keyCode:   code,
+                       modifiers: modifiers,
+                       r:         0,
+               }, true
+       }
+
+       // If we were given one character, then we've got a rune.
+       if len(k) == 1 {
+               return Key{
+                       keyCode:   tcell.KeyRune,
+                       modifiers: modifiers,
+                       r:         rune(k[0]),
+               }, true
+       }
+
+       // We don't know what happened.
+       return Key{}, false
+}
+
+// findAction will find 'action' using string 'v'
+func findAction(v string) (action func(*View) bool) {
+       action, ok := bindingActions[v]
+       if !ok {
+               // If the user seems to be binding a function that doesn't exist
+               // We hope that it's a lua function that exists and bind it to that
+               action = LuaFunctionBinding(v)
+       }
+       return action
+}
+
+// BindKey takes a key and an action and binds the two together
+func BindKey(k, v string) {
+       key, ok := findKey(k)
+       if !ok {
+               return
+       }
+       if v == "ToggleHelp" {
+               helpBinding = k
+       }
+
+       actionNames := strings.Split(v, ",")
+       actions := make([]func(*View) bool, 0, len(actionNames))
+       for _, actionName := range actionNames {
+               actions = append(actions, findAction(actionName))
        }
+
+       bindings[key] = actions
 }
